Aurora hops are amazing and very versatile, so if you can,  I highly recommend sticking with them. If you want to sub, styrian goldings would be somewhat close, for domestic hops northern brewer would get you in the ballpark as well.

BeerSmith:

Also called Super Styrian. This is a hybrid between Northern Brewer and TG. It has a pleasant hoppy aroma similar to Styrian Goldings but lighter.
Used for: Often mixed with other hops in lagers.
Substitutes: Styrian Goldings

Personally, I would recommend Perle.  Perle was the original kettle hop used in SN Porter.  I suspect that SN switched to Aurora because Perle became less plentiful. Aurora and Perle were both derived from Northern Brewer.
